Brits spend £300 million every month on their streaming habit

Millennials are the ‘most addicted’ generation with 11.8 per cent subscribing to at least three streaming services

Brits spend £303.16 million every month on streaming services, according to new research by Mortar London on behalf of price comparison site Finder.com.

According to the figures, more than 17 million British viewers – or 41.1 per cent of the population – are subscribed to at least one streaming service. On average, people are paying an estimated £17.17 each month for the likes of Netflix, Amazon Prime, Now TV and HayU.

The research also found that millennials are the ‘most addicted’ generation with 11.8 per cent subscribing to three or more streaming services, costing them more than £20 per month on average.

Netflix is the most popular service, with 59.7 per cent of Brits subscribing, followed by 47.5 per cent subscribing to Amazon Prime. The Netflix subscriber figure is much higher for millennials, with 69.4 per cent believed to have a subscription.
